China Launches Sky Train

China Skytrain

China has launched it sky train. China’s first sky train came off the assembly line in the city of Nanjing, making it third country after Germany and Japan to develop the technology. China is the third country to invent this lovely technology that move faster without hold up. The Word Of God The heart of men […]

Page 80 of 203« First...36...798081...8487...Last »
Information Hood © 2016 - 2018 Follow us on Facebook